    Here are three examples of specifying error documents which will be called for a given error condition (note that you can use relative "thisfile.html" or absolute addressing "/full-path -to-your-account/thisfile.html"): 
    
    ErrorDocument 401 /401.html 
    ErrorDocument 403 /403.html 
    ErrorDocument 404 /404.html
